How to Implement Each Strategy Effectively
1. Segment Customers by Device Usage Patterns
Overview:
Divide your customer base into distinct groups based on shared device usage behaviors to enable targeted marketing.
Implementation Steps:
- Collect telemetry data including usage frequency, feature adoption, and operational hours.
- Apply clustering algorithms or manual analysis to identify meaningful user segments.
- Develop detailed personas representing each segment’s unique needs and preferences.
- Design targeted campaigns with offers tailored to each segment.
Example:
A smart circuit breaker manufacturer targets high-load users with energy-saving upgrade offers, increasing upsell conversions.
Recommended Tools:
Power BI, Tableau, and Looker for data visualization and segmentation; platforms like Zigpoll to collect customer insights that validate and refine segments.
2. Implement Predictive Maintenance Marketing
Overview:
Leverage AI and device data to forecast failures before they occur, enabling proactive service marketing.
Implementation Steps:
- Establish real-time monitoring dashboards tracking device health indicators.
- Develop machine learning models to detect failure patterns and anomalies.
- Trigger automated marketing alerts notifying customers of upcoming maintenance needs.
- Bundle service contracts or warranties with predictive alerts to increase renewal rates.
Example:
An industrial sensor supplier sends automated recalibration offers before sensor accuracy declines, reducing downtime.

4. Develop Usage-Based Pricing and Subscription Models
Overview:
Create pricing models that adjust based on real-time device usage metrics to align cost with customer value.
Implementation Steps:
- Define key usage metrics (e.g., kWh, operating hours).
- Develop tiered pricing plans aligned with consumption levels.
- Integrate billing systems with device telemetry for automated invoicing.
- Provide customers with dashboards showing usage and cost to reinforce perceived value.
Example:
A renewable energy inverter company offers subscriptions that adjust monthly fees based on energy processed, improving client retention.

5. Run Event-Triggered Marketing Campaigns
Overview:
Automate marketing messages triggered by specific device events such as firmware updates, alerts, or error codes.
Implementation Steps:
- Identify critical device events warranting customer communication.
- Build automated workflows in marketing automation platforms.
- Craft personalized messages tailored to each event type.
- Monitor campaign performance and optimize based on engagement metrics.
Example:
A smart meter company sends upgrade offers when firmware vulnerabilities are detected, enhancing security and customer trust.

Key Term Mini-Definitions
- Connected Device Marketing: Marketing strategies leveraging data generated by IoT devices to personalize customer engagement and optimize product offerings.
- Predictive Maintenance: Using data analytics and AI to forecast and proactively prevent equipment failures.
- Customer Segmentation: Dividing a customer base into groups based on shared characteristics or behaviors.
- Event-Triggered Campaigns: Automated marketing messages initiated by specific user or device actions.
- Usage-Based Pricing: Pricing models that adjust according to actual product or service usage.
